Transaction 3418384ebf65666678987c06934d2832c22373d06162297dd4bd2b2f88f3c07e
1 Input
1 Output
-
3418384ebf65666678987c06934d2832c22373d06162297dd4bd2b2f88f3c07e:0
- value
- 734157
- script pubkey
- OP_0 OP_PUSHBYTES_20 f23b70c6ea822bd5992264024660f4b624c9989f
- address
- bc1q7gahp3h2sg4atxfzvspyvc85kcjvnxyl8xkgzc